Omar and other Sufi poets used popular similes and pictured the ordinary joys
of life so that the worldly man could compare mundane pleasures with the
superior joys experienced in the spiritual life. To the man who drinks wine in
order to forget, temporarily, the unbearable sorrows and trials of his life, Omar
off ers a delightful alternative: the nectar of divine ecstasy, which leads to divine
enlightenment, thereby obliterating human woe permanently. Surely Omar did
not go through the labor of writing so many exquisite verses merely to inspire
people to escape sorrow by drugging their senses with alcohol!
